Transaction 133daf8077b3e683249e4803fe34a5fe28b9697c10cb347019c4a8476fa0bb56
1 Input
1 Outputs
- 133daf8077b3e683249e4803fe34a5fe28b9697c10cb347019c4a8476fa0bb56:0
value 27546559
address 3LJydTA3w8BrGaAC314gwP7Wmry1rVSjsQ